- PPaulPhiladelphia County •2 reviews5.0Dined 3 days agoWe celebrated our anniversary on Valentines Day along with a million Eagles fans in town for the victory parade. The Oyster House was a bit crowded, but very understanding about our tardiness due to street closures. Julian, our server, was polite, helpful and attentive. My wife had the crab cake and I had the cod. Both were well prepared and nicely presented. The snapper soup was quite good as well. All in all, the Oyster House was a very good experience.More infoOyster House PhiladelphiaPrice: Very Expensive• Seafood• Center City•4.9

- JJanPhiladelphia County •16 reviews5.0Dined 5 days agoWe enjoyed Parc on a cold, snowy evening in February. The restaurant was cozy and warm, and the feeling was too! Our server, Jose, was great - friendly and with just the right amount of check-ins. The beet salad was yummy, with lots of beets cooked to perfection and a great mix of flavors. We both enjoyed Trout Amandine - a large portion with a hearty helping of haricots verts. The cranberry walnut bread was also delicious! We will go back tomorrow to buy a loaf to take home! If only the glass of wine wasn’t so pricey. But who can have a meal like this without a glass of wine?More infoParcPrice: Expensive• French• Rittenhouse Square•4.8
